postgresql数据库怎么远程连接

2023-04-16 23:37:00 postgresql 数据库 连接

PostgreSQL数据库可以通过远程连接来提供安全可靠的跨网络数据库服务。远程连接PostgreSQL数据库的步骤如下:

1. 确保PostgreSQL服务器可以被远程连接:首先要确保PostgreSQL服务器可以被远程连接,需要修改PostgreSQL的配置文件postgresql.conf,其中的listen_addresses参数需要设置为*,这样PostgreSQL服务器才会监听任何IP地址的连接请求。

2. 确保PostgreSQL服务器的防火墙设置正确:如果服务器上安装了防火墙,那么需要确保PostgreSQL服务器的防火墙设置正确,以允许远程连接请求通过。

3. 修改PostgreSQL用户认证方式:PostgreSQL服务器默认使用本地认证方式,这样会导致远程连接失败,因此需要修改PostgreSQL的认证方式为“md5”,以允许远程连接。

4. 创建远程连接用户:在PostgreSQL服务器上创建一个新的用户,这个用户将用于远程连接PostgreSQL服务器,并且需要给这个用户指定一个可以访问PostgreSQL服务器的IP地址,以允许这个用户从这个IP地址远程连接PostgreSQL服务器。

5. 使用客户端工具进行远程连接:最后,使用客户端工具(如pgAdmin)连接PostgreSQL服务器,输入刚才创建的用户名和密码,就可以成功连接PostgreSQL服务器了。

以上就是PostgreSQL数据库远程连接的步骤,比较简单,只要操作正确,就可以轻松实现远程连接。

相关文章